Course Content

• Principles of Genetics and Molecular Biology
• Genetic Engineering Techniques: PCR, Cloning, and Sequencing
• CRISPR-Cas9 Gene Editing Technology and Applications
• Recombinant DNA Technology and its Applications
• Cell Culture and Transfection Techniques
• Microbial Genetics and Genetic Manipulation
• Bioinformatics and Data Analysis for Genetic Engineering
• Laboratory Safety and Ethical Considerations in Genetic Engineering
• Quality Assurance and Quality Control in Genetic Engineering Laboratories

Career Role Description
Genetic Engineering Laboratory Technician Conduct experiments, maintain lab equipment, and assist senior scientists in genetic research projects. High demand for meticulous and detail-oriented individuals.
Molecular Biology Technician (Genetic Engineering Focus) Specialize in molecular techniques essential for genetic engineering, such as PCR and gene cloning. Strong analytical and problem-solving skills are crucial.
Biotechnology Technician (Genetic Engineering) Apply genetic engineering principles to various biotech applications, including pharmaceuticals and agriculture. Excellent teamwork and communication skills are required.
